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- • ASA I-Ⅲ female patients scheduled for unilateral total knee arthroplasty
Exclusion
- Patients younger than 18 years of age
- ASA Ⅳ and above patients
- Having previous knee surgery on the same side
- Patients with allergies to drugs to be used in the study
- Contraindication for spinal anesthesia
- Body mass index 40 kg / m2 and above patients
- Opioid tolerance
- Patients with neurological or psychiatric disorders
- Patients who do not have the ability to use patient controlled analgesia device
